Summary
- Bank of Japan Governor Kazuo Ueda has been hospitalized due to an infectious disease.
- Finance Minister Shunichi Suzuki stated that this will not affect the upcoming monetary policy meeting scheduled for next week.
- The assurance from the Finance Minister aims to maintain confidence in Japan's financial stability.
- Analysts will be closely watching the meeting for any potential shifts in policy direction despite the governor's absence.
